This lecture introduces the basics of linear programming, focusing on defining corners, extreme points, and feasible solutions within polyhedrons. It covers the standard form of equality and inequality constraints, adding slack variables, and determining extreme points. The instructor explains the concept of basic feasible solutions and the uniqueness of extreme points in polyhedrons.
